Redmi Note 10 collection pricing, availability

Redmi Note 10 is available in two storage variants. The four GB RAM + 64 GB storage variant is priced at Rs 11,999 whereas the 6 GB RAM + 128 GB storage variant will price you Rs 13,999. It will go on sale on 16 March on Amazon and Mi.com

Redmi Note 10 Pro is available in three storage variants. The 6 GB RAM + 64 GB storage variant is priced at 15,999, the 6 GB RAM + 128 GB storage variant is priced at Rs 16,999 and eight GB RAM + 128 GB storage variant is priced at 18,999.  It will go on sale on 17 March on Amazon and Mi.com

Redmi Note 10 Pro Max can be accessible in three storage variants. The 6 GB RAM + 64 GB storage variant is priced at Rs 18,999, the 6 GB RAM + 128 GB storage variant is priced at Rs 19,999 and eight GB RAM + 128 GB storage variant will price you Rs 21,999. It will be accessible for buy on 18 March on Amazon and Mi.com

Conclusion

Redmi Note 10 Pro and Redmi Note 10 Pro Max include the identical specs aside from the digicam. So, until you actually care about the 108 MP quad digicam, you’ll be able to ditch the Pro Max mannequin. Also, whereas we’re but to check the smartphone, it is notable to say that the 108 MP major sensor although seems good on paper, Google Pixel collection is proof that the variety of megapixels and sensors could not essentially translate to premium image high quality. But that is to not say that it is not attention-grabbing that the 108 MP camera-sporting Redmi Note 10 Pro Max is priced at Rs 21,000, whereas the OG Galaxy S21 Ultra with 108 MP digicam tech prices over Rs 70,000.

Talking about the Redmi Note 10, it is not a lot of a soar from its predecessor because it has a smaller battery (Note 10: 5,000 mAh, Note 9: 5,020 mAh), faster-charging velocity (Note 10: 33 W, Note 9: 22.5 W), related 48 MP quad-camera setup, identical dimension show and the identical 13 MP selfie digicam.
